Multiple execution of instruction loops within a processor...

Electrical computers and digital processing systems: processing – Processing control – Branching

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

Reexamination Certificate

active

06959379

ABSTRACT:
A method of executing loops in a computer system is described. The computer system has a sequence of instructions held in program memory and a prefetch buffer which holds instructions fetched from the memory ready for supply to a decoder of the computer system. If the size of the loop to be executed is such that it can by holly contained within the prefetch buffer, this is detected and a lock is put on the prefetch buffer to retain the loop within it while the loop is executed a requisite number of times. This thus allows power to be saved and reduces the overhead on the memory access buffers. According to another aspect, loops can be “skipped” by holding a value of zero in the loop counter register.

REFERENCES:
patent: 4566063 (1986-01-01), Zolnowsky et al.
patent: 4714994 (1987-12-01), Oklobdzija et al.
patent: 4727483 (1988-02-01), Saxe
patent: 4876642 (1989-10-01), Gibson
patent: 5511178 (1996-04-01), Takeda et al.
patent: 5623615 (1997-04-01), Salem et al.
patent: 5657485 (1997-08-01), Streitenberger et al.
patent: 6038649 (2000-03-01), Ozawa et al.
patent: 6145076 (2000-11-01), Gabzdyl et al.
patent: 0 487 082 (1992-05-01), None
patent: 0 511 484 (1992-11-01), None
patent: 0 864 970 (1998-09-01), None
Rosenberg, Jerry M. Dictionary of Computers, Information Processing, and Telecommunications. Second Edition. New York: John Wiley & Sons, Inc. ©1987. p. 161.
Kloker K.L.,The Mororola DSP56000 Digital Signal Processor, IEEE Micro, vol. 6, No. 6, Dec. 1, 1986 pp. 29-48, XP000211994, ISSN: 0272-1732.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Multiple execution of instruction loops within a processor... does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Multiple execution of instruction loops within a processor..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Multiple execution of instruction loops within a processor... will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-3455352

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.